Ground rent vs service charge
Service charge covers running the building (insurance, cleaning, repairs). Ground rent is a contractual payment to the freeholder. Since the Leasehold and Freehold Reform Act 2024, new ground rents on new leases are generally peppercorn (zero), but existing leases may still have significant ground rent.
